industrial ovens and furnaces
Industrial ovens and furnaces are sophisticated thermal processing equipment essential for various manufacturing and production processes. These systems are engineered to provide precise temperature control, uniform heat distribution, and efficient thermal processing capabilities. They come in various configurations, including batch ovens, continuous ovens, chamber furnaces, and tunnel kilns, each designed to meet specific industrial requirements. Modern industrial ovens and furnaces incorporate advanced features such as programmable temperature controls, multiple heating zones, and automated material handling systems. They operate across a wide temperature range, from low-temperature curing processes to high-temperature heat treatment applications exceeding 2000°F. These systems utilize different heating methods, including electric resistance, gas-fired, infrared, and induction heating, offering flexibility for diverse industrial applications. They serve crucial roles in metal heat treatment, powder coating curing, ceramic firing, glass manufacturing, and various other industrial processes. Advanced insulation technologies and energy recovery systems ensure optimal thermal efficiency while maintaining precise temperature uniformity throughout the workspace.
